What is your earliest Internet memory?
When I was an undergraduate at the University of California in the early 80s, I was in a Linguistics class where they gave us what was later called an email address. This worked within the UC computer system and we used it to submit homework, ask the professor questions, and have personal communications (about class-related content/work) with other students in the class.
I remember it seemed almost mystical. The idea of personal computers (Apple was just launching) being able to communicate in a web or network was mind-boggling. Later on, we learned about its beginnings on "The Well," out of San Francisco, and I time it with the original MacIntosh (?) and the gray scale graphics. Some time later on, I was signing up on BBS's on a rudimentary pc at home, and eventually AOL, which used graphics that were "drawn" with repeated keyboard characters at the time--I kid you not! I'd love to flesh out this memory with others who were primed at that time to embrace the new technology. I'd also love to hear anyone of any age's story about early internet experiences. ~the tapu |

Early 90s in college. Had a professor who was insisting that we all communicate with him via email. Which meant going to a computer lab and getting an account, and so on. So I didn't. And the teacher was frustrated.
Then a different teacher, not my teacher, and someone who I had become good friends with through a writing group, told me about email and took me to the lab to set up an account with me and we both emailed and did some archaic version of instant messaging and I was like, Whoa. Then said teacher got totally addicted to the wealth of worthless and some worthy information on the internet and spent a couple of months staying up all night at the computer lab printing stacks of paper. Including a list of the 20 most creative ways to fail your finals in college. Which he printed and we ran around campus at 2am tacking up on the walls of big test rooms. A few years later I was working on my senior thesis and it turned out most of my information (data on violence against women in prison) was available online through underground sources, vs in books or newspapers, and I was one of the first people in my department to turn in a thesis largely sourced from internet research, rather than books. ( I still did good old fashioned letter writing and interviews, but due to the nature of the subject, there was a lot more info online than individuals who wanted to go on the record talking to me) I didn't know how to copy paste, so I had to hand write out all of the URLs in my notebook and then type them out again on paper to site sources. I feel very old now. |
